    This event space which is located at the heart of downtown Round Rock is relatively small and is…read moreprobably less than 2000 ft.² inside. It's a great place for a medium sized company meeting of 40 or so people. The obvious problem I spotted was that you are relegated to street parking since they only have a handful of spaces in back. Some of the pros I will mention are the fact that they do actually have an elevator off to the side of the building. Upstairs in the Center they do have a full kitchen complete with refrigerator and dishwasher. There is a nice outdoor balcony with additional seating and there are two glass garage doors which can be raised. They have a nice lounge area in the corner along with two bathrooms located behind the kitchen. There is a 6 x 8' flat screen for presentations on the side wall along with a smaller 3 x 4' one on the other wall. They also have plenty of tables and chairs for the event space if you need them. There does seem to be an area which appears to be a stage area, although it only has two plugs, but it does have some effect lighting. As for the cons, I've already mentioned that you will be competing for street parking. The upstairs room itself has no sound deadening material so it gets very loud. No laminate or carpeted flooring, just concrete. Basically, this is just a good acceptable 31/2 star venue to host corporate meetings or quiet remembrances.
